Medical Abortion: A Detailed Guide

Medical abortion, also known as the abortion pill, includes a combination of pills to stop a gestation . This process is generally offered up to a defined gestational age , often roughly 10-12 weeks from the last menstrual period . The procedure involves with administered mifepristone, which prevents progesterone, and then misoprostol, which stimulates uterine spasms. Patients should be advised about the possible complications , such as bleeding , cramping, and the chance of incomplete termination which necessitates additional medical attention .

The Risks of Buying Abortion Pills Online

Acquiring drugs for abortion online presents substantial risks. Regularly, these sources are unregulated , increasing the likelihood of receiving fake products, wrong dosages, or medications which are past their use date. This can lead to adverse health consequences , including critical bleeding, infection, unfinished abortion leading to subsequent medical treatment , and undetected ectopic pregnancies, which are dangerous . Furthermore, lack of medical supervision and required counseling after the process may have long-term emotional and physical effects . It is crucial to seek care from a qualified healthcare provider for safe and appropriate reproductive health .
